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 1966278 0343
98546459961 01223636
98546459961 01223636
417684 37013 71
All about undefined
Interested in learning more?
98546459961 01223636
417684 37013 71
See more
11869 3048664 616461201
6174958 866811851 19692482 602 26943
See more
2018994065 3522 65
3181837122 78 40700 55 04
See more